NOVELTY - An aqueous organic epoxy zinc-rich coating comprises component (A) comprising aqueous epoxy graphene zinc powder paint comprising 15-35 pts. wt. E51-type epoxy resin, 0.3-2.0 pts. wt. dispersant, 0.05-1.0 pt. wt. defoamer, 0.2-1.0 pt. wt. leveling agent, 20-70 pts. wt. zinc powder, 0.1-2 pts. wt. graphene, 15-40 pts. wt. talc, 0.5-5 pts. wt. hydrated magnesium silicate, 5-15 pts. wt. propylene glycol methyl ether, and component (B) comprising aqueous epoxy component comprising 70-90 pts. wt. aqueous epoxy curing agent and 10-25 pts. wt. deionized water. The aqueous epoxy curing agent is prepared by adding liquid epoxy Epon resin 828 (RTM: difunctional bisphenol A/epichlorohydrin) and triethylenetetramine to propylene glycol methyl ether, stirring at 60-70 degrees C and 500-800 rpm to form adduct, performing Mannich reaction by mixing 0.4 mol/L sodium lignosulfonate and sodium hydroxide aqueous solution for 5-8 minutes, adding adduct, stirring, adding formaldehyde and heating. USE - Aqueous organic epoxy zinc-rich coating. ADVANTAGE - The coating has excellent corrosion resistance, physical and mechanical properties, electrical conductivity and shielding properties due to use of graphene oxide, does not contain volatile organic compound, and is environmentally-friendly. The aqueous epoxy curing agent has excellent flexibility.
